Economic Deflation: A Brief Overview

Deflation is an economic phenomenon characterized by a sustained decrease in the general price level of goods and services. It occurs when the supply of money and credit in an economy is inadequate to support the current level of economic activity. During deflationary periods, consumers tend to cut back on spending, causing a decline in demand for various products and services, including gaming.

As the prices of goods and services decrease, consumers may delay their purchases in anticipation of even lower prices in the future. This hesitation can have a significant impact on industries that rely heavily on consumer spending, such as the gaming industry.

Furthermore, deflation can lead to an increase in the real value of debt. When prices are falling, the amount of money owed remains the same, but the purchasing power of that money increases. This can make it more difficult for individuals and businesses to repay their debts, potentially leading to financial instability.

Revising Pricing Strategies for Gaming Products

One effective way to navigate deflation is by revising pricing strategies. During times of economic downturn, consumers may have limited disposable income and be more price-sensitive. Marketers should carefully analyze price elasticity to determine how changes in price will impact demand.

Reducing prices or introducing more affordable gaming options can attract consumers who are looking to make budget-conscious decisions. However, it is essential to strike a balance between affordability and maintaining desired profit margins. By monitoring competitor pricing and conducting market research, marketers can make informed decisions about pricing strategies that benefit both the consumer and the company.

Additionally, marketers should consider implementing promotional offers or discounts to incentivize purchases. This can help stimulate demand and attract price-conscious gamers who may be hesitant to spend during deflationary periods.
